Description

A beautifully presented bungalow, ideally located ona good sized corner plot. With a large sitting room, dining area, and at present configured with two kitchens, one of which could be converted into a bedroom/study reception room. Three main bedrooms and a shower room.
Bar Hill is just over seven miles north of the historic city of Cambridge, with a mainline railway station and a wide range of shops and amenities. Within Bar Hill there is a primary school, and several shops including a large Tesco store.
